Chelsea are handing over David Datro Fofana to Süper Lig promoted Göztepe

Chelsea FC have finally found a buyer for ex-Union player David Datro Fofana. After an announced move to AEK Athens was not possible, the 21-year-old moved to Turkey on deadline day. Göztepe has loaned Fofana for a year, and the Süper Lig newcomers also secured an option to buy. As in Berlin, Chelsea are said to have a clause that would allow them to end the loan early in January.

The Blues had been trying to sell the attacker all summer. Fofana still has a long-term contract in London until 2029, but has not trained with the first team recently. Now Chelsea have agreed to a new loan. With a market value of 12 million euros, Fofana is by far the most valuable professional in Göztepe’s squad.

In January 2023, Chelsea paid 12 million euros for Fofana to Norwegian club Molde FK. Loans to Union Berlin and Burnley FC followed. For the Köpenickers, he was involved in three goals in 17 games in the first half of the 2023/24 season before Chelsea brought him back. Fofana then scored five goals in 15 games for the Clarets.
